Postcode TS21 4ET is located in a rural town, within the Sedgefield ward of County Durham in the North East region, and forms part of the Trimdon & Fishburn area. It has high deprivation and moderate crime levels, with around 53.1 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. The average income per household in Trimdon & Fishburn is £38,952 per year. The nearest station is Newton Aycliffe located about 7.7 miles away. There are 1 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Based on 159 recent sales, the median property price is £175,000 in Sedgefield area, with individual transactions ranging from £48,500 up to £540,000.
Price distribution per property type (last year)
Median sale price and percentiles per property type (last year)
| Type | Sales | Median |
|---|---|---|
| Detached | 44 | £301,750 |
| Flats | 17 | £73,500 |
| Semi-Detached | 50 | £172,500 |
| Terraced | 48 | £133,975 |
